Strategy Overview

Due to its good overall bulk and power, Reuniclus is one of the premier Psychic-types in the tier. Most walls can't touch it after it gets a Calm Mind under its belt, as its access to recovery and good bulk let it set up on a large portion of the tier, and it is unaffected by residual damage thanks to Magic Guard, which also benefits Trick Room sets greatly, as Reuniclus won't have to worry about taking recoil from Life Orb. Reuniclus also has a huge base 125 Special Attack, which complements its bulk nicely and makes it dangerous for offensive teams to face if it sets up Trick Room. However, there are a good number of flaws that hold Reuniclus back, as its Speed is horrendous outside of Trick Room, which makes it vulnerable to common offensive Pokemon such as Hydreigon and Heracross when coupled with its mediocre defensive typing.
